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the proposed development on the neighbouring properties, with particular regard to 9a Artillery Passage and 52-54 Artillery Lane
- Whether the proposed development makes sufficient provision of refuse storage and collection, cycle parking provision, and step-free access
What decided it
The effect on neighbouring amenity would not be so great as to warrant refusal, particularly given the neutral overall impact on 9a Artillery Passage's rear yard and the lesser effect on the commercial ground floor of 52-54 Artillery Lane.
Plan policies cited: Policy D3 London Plan 2021, Policy D.DH8 Tower Hamlets Local Plan 2031, Policy D5 London Plan, Policy S.TR1 Tower Hamlets Local Plan
